EXTREMELY LONG! Be prepared for 3+ hours. Most of it is sent waiting on certain parts of the aessessment. There were multiple candidates in certain stations. You have an actual "interview" which consists of 2 individuals. Then there's an electrical portion which leans on the side if being a bit much. Directions were somewhat vague. No real question on electrical theory, just identifying components and wiring up a contactor. Then there's a mechanical section which consists of you rebuilding an industry specific component which places those who were not familiar with the manfacturing industry at a disadvantage. Then you waited another 30 mins for an HR rep to ask you how things were. All in all they were nice however the whole process just seems a bit much.
